Curtis Stone Culinary Training Path
Stone pursued structured culinary education in Australia before refining his skills through demanding kitchen roles. Training in classic French techniques gave him a versatile base for modern menu creation.
Working in high-pressure restaurant environments taught him discipline, timing, and leadership, all of which are evident in his efficient television cooking style.
Curtis Stone Television and Cookbook Impact
His move to Los Angeles expanded his reach beyond Australia, transforming him into a recognizable face on international television. Shows like "Foody Call" and "Kitchen Cousins" highlight his ability to connect with home cooks.
In addition to television, Stone has released multiple cookbooks and partnered on product lines, reinforcing his status as a global food entrepreneur rather than only a television chef.
